From March 6–8, 2026, the Veterans Film Foundation proudly presents the Red Poppy Film Festival at the Art Gallery of NSW—a moving celebration of storytelling, creativity, and remembrance. This inspiring event showcases films created by veterans and filmmakers who capture the realities of war, service, and sacrifice through powerful narratives and stunning cinematic craft. Attendees will experience an unforgettable line-up of feature films, documentaries, and short works, all vying for the prestigious Red Poppy Awards honoring excellence in storytelling, direction, performance, and contributions to a deeper understanding of the service experience. The festival opens with a spectacular Opening Night featuring the Red Poppy Awards presentation, premiere screenings, art display and a vibrant cocktail gala that brings together current and former service members, their families, the film industry and supporters.
